Service Comparison: Installation, Fit, and Ongoing Support

Not all services are equal, even when the hardware looks similar. Compare how each provider measures openings, handles uneven masonry, and aligns tracks or hinges for smooth operation. Strong service includes a site assessment, a clear quote with parts and labour details, and a workmanship process that reduces gaps where intruders could probe. Ask clear screen door about warranty coverage, replacement policies for damaged components, and whether the company offers routine checks like alignment, latch performance, and screen integrity. A provider that explains these steps typically delivers a more consistent fit and longer-lasting performance than one that only focuses on product selection.

Performance Factors That Matter for Security and Visibility

For effective protection, evaluate frame material, locking points, mesh or screen construction, and how the system handles everyday use. Doors should be easy for staff to open and close without sacrificing security features. Consider whether the design allows strong daytime visibility while still resisting prying and cutting attempts. If your business needs airflow, a configuration can support ventilation while adding a practical layer of defence. Also look for smooth, secure latching and durable hardware that withstands frequent use, rather than relying on basic components that can loosen over time.
